Members of the Royal College of ... WebNov 2, 2024 · At first, many older adults pay for care in part with their own money. They may use personal savings, a pension or other retirement fund, income from stocks and bonds, or proceeds from the sale of a home. … WebMost people who move into a nursing home begin by paying for their care from private funds and out-of-pocket. In order to qualify for Medicaid and have the government pay for it, you must first use up all your assets and resources. For an assisted living facility, it costs … WebThrough the state Medicaid plan, nursing home care is covered for elderly and disabled individuals. In-home personal care is also provided via the Medicaid State Plan and is known as the Medical Assistance Personal Care (MAPC) program. Via this program, assistance with daily activities is provided.
